Tender description

Council have recently undergone a £1.6m renovation and refurbishment of the ECOS Centre in Ballymena with a focus on accommodating up to 125 employees in a business Innovation Centre managed by Catalyst Inc. The facility will be the location of choice for a number of innovative companies as well as hosting a number of national and international conferences, and it is expected that the facility will be officially launched in the spring.
